Introduction:
Insulin is a very important hormone produced by the pancreas in the body. It helps in maintaining an optimum level of glucose levels in the blood. The increase or decrease in the glucose levels is harmful to the body. Lack of insulin affects the blood glucose level and causes diabetes in the individual.
